Ordinals
beta
Address 1MtAv1uNWA5fyoY2ySvFfNTAFPv2MuAirB
sat balance
3566
runes balances
outputs
f1adb8ae23f64d7355867a9bba9e0b3c24945dc872b89138b5bcd42e1a68d4e8:0